作家
登录

使用视图快速获得Flashback Query闪回查询数据

作者: 来源: 2017-10-27 09:25:23 阅读 我要评论

沙龙晃荡 | 去哪儿、陌陌、ThoughtWorks在主动化运维中的实践!10.28不见不散!


应用视图快速获得Flashback Query闪回萌芽数据

本文给出应用视图协助我们快速构造闪回萌芽内容,经由过程视图可以便利的检索“汗青上的数据”。

1.构造闪回萌芽视图需求描述

1)预备员工表和工资表

2)删除工资表中雇佣年限在1994年之前的记录

3)创建视图可以萌芽工资表删除之前的记录

2.预备情况

1)预备员工表和工资表

  1. sec@ora10g> create table emp (id number,name varchar2(20), e_date date); 
  2.  
  3. Table created. 
  4.  
  5. sec@ora10g> create table salary (id number, salary number); 
  6.  
  7. Table created.  

salary表中包含员工ID和薪水信息。

2)初始化数据

  1. insert into emp values (1,'Secooler',to_date('1991-01-01','yyyy-mm-dd')); 
  2.  
  3. insert into emp values (2,'Andy',to_date('1992-01-01','yyyy-mm-dd')); 
  4.  
  5. insert into emp values (3,'HOU',to_date('2010-01-01','yyyy-mm-dd')); 
  6.  
  7. insert into emp values (4,'Shengwen',to_date('2011-01-01','yyyy-mm-dd')); 
  8.  
  9. commit
  10.  
  11. insert into salary values (1,60000); 
  12.  
  13. insert into salary values (2,50000); 
  14.  
  15. insert into salary values (3,40000); 
  16.  
  17. insert into salary values (4,30000); 
  18.  
  19. commit 

3)获取初始化数据内容

  1. sec@ora10g> select * from emp; 

      推荐阅读

      简易Python Selenium爬虫实现歌曲免费下载

    沙龙晃荡 | 去哪儿、陌陌、ThoughtWorks在主动化运维中的实践!10.28不见不散! 比来发明越来越多的歌曲下载都须要缴费了,对保护正版是功德。但有的时刻也想钻个空子,正好比来在进修pyth>>>详细阅读


    本文标题:使用视图快速获得Flashback Query闪回查询数据

    地址:http://www.17bianji.com/lsqh/38268.html

关键词: 探索发现

乐购科技部分新闻及文章转载自互联网,供读者交流和学习,若有涉及作者版权等问题请及时与我们联系,以便更正、删除或按规定办理。感谢所有提供资讯的网站,欢迎各类媒体与乐购科技进行文章共享合作。

网友点评
自媒体专栏

评论

热度

精彩导读
栏目ID=71的表不存在(操作类型=0)